Hunter acquitted of killing man mistaken for bear 
Saturday, Feb 23, 2013 11:33 AM PST
SALEM, Ore. (AP) â€" An Oregon hunter has been found not guilty of manslaughter in the shooting death of a Marine reservist from California he says he mistook for a bear.

Las Vegas seen as dangerous even as crime drops 
Saturday, Feb 23, 2013 08:30 AM PST
FILE - In this Feb. 21, 2013 file photo, law enforcement personal investigate the scene of a mulit-vehicle accident on Las Vegas Blvd and Flamingo Road. Variously known as an adult playground and Disneyland for grown-ups, Las Vegas has worked to brand itself as a place where tourists can enjoy a sense of edginess with no real danger. But a series of high-profile and seemingly random incidents that have left visitors to the Strip dead or in the hospital is threatening Sin City’s reputation as a padded room of a town where people can cut loose with no fear of consequences. Ghana defender Paintsil arrested after wife attacked: police 
Saturday, Feb 23, 2013 07:30 AM PST
ACCRA (Reuters) - Ghanaian international soccer player John Paintsil was arrested but released on bail after he was accused of stabbing his wife, a police official said. Accra police spokesman Freeman Tettey said on Saturday the former West Ham United player was taken into custody on Friday after he was accused of the stabbing attack by a neighbour. Paintsil, who has not been formally charged pending an investigation, said there had been a "misunderstanding" with his wife Richlove, Tettey said. ...

Report: Ohio dad sentenced, put kids in boxes 
Friday, Feb 22, 2013 09:17 PM PST
STEUBENVILLE, Ohio (AP) â€" An eastern Ohio father has been sentenced to six months in prison for punishing his three children by forcing them into plastic storage boxes sealed with duct tape and a square cut in the top for air.
